This study presents the nonconformable fractional Elzaki transform (NCFET) method. We used this method to solve various fractional differential equations (FDEs) with nonconformable fractional derivatives (NCFDs). We studied and proved the basic properties and advantages of this new method. We discussed some examples and conducted a comparative study, presenting exact results through graphs and tables. The results showed that the new method worked well, was easy to use, and could correctly solve several fractional differential equations, even those with nonconformable fractional derivatives.
